Perspectives on the Biostatistical Sciences:
A Symposium in Memory of Samuel W. Greenhouse
Lister Hill Conference Center
National Institutes of Health
Bethesda, Maryland

n June 11, 2001, a scientific meeting will be held celebrating the career and professional accomplishments of Samuel W. Greenhouse. Sam's affiliations at the George Washington University and the National Institutes of Health spanned over 50 years during which he had a profound influence on statistical practice. Jointly sponsored by the GWU Biostatistics Center, the National Institutes of Health, and the Washington Statistical Society, the program will include sessions concentrating on Sam's contributions to statistical theory, epidemiologic methods, the theory and practice of clinical trials, and collaborations in the biomedical and behavioral sciences. Sessions will be an integrated mix of reflections of Sam's work and current topics in the biostatistical sciences.

Attendance will be limited, and advance registration is required. A cocktail hour and dinner with speakers the proceeding evening, June 10, will be available by separate ticket.
